Study Summary
This study is an open label Phase II study to evaluate the safety and efficacy of AMX0035 in adults with Wolfram syndrome.
Primary Outcome
* C-peptide area under the curve (AUC) response at Week 24 using a 0-240 minute MMTT * Change from Baseline in area under the curve (AUC) in delta C-peptide at Week 24 using a 0-240 minute MMTT
